By Surgeon A. E. K. Stephens, Bengal Medical Service. 1. SuhJcur.?The wing received orders on the 21st November 1878 to march the nest day to Jacobabad for the purpose of performing escort duty from that place to Quetta. 2. Kahars Drill, &c.?The time at Sukkur, 9th November to the 22nd, had been devoted to drilling and exercising the doolie bearers in their work, showing them how to pick up the wounded, practising them in route marching, &c. Drummers of the regiment had been instructed in minor surgery, showing them where to compress the larger arteries and how to apply a field tourniquet. 3.
